Herb Library: Horsetail
Botanical Names
equisetum arvense
Common Names
snake grass, bottlebrush, shave grass, scouring rush, puzzle grass, candock, field horsetail, common horsetail, giant horsetail, paddock pipes, pewterwort
Plant Description
Horsetail grows in the temperate regions of Asia, North America, and Europe. It is a non-flowering perennial plant with stems that look like a feathery tail and is a close relative to the fern. Horsetail gets its name from the latin word "Equisetum" which means horse bristle.
Parts of Horsetail Used in Dietary Supplements
The aerial parts of Horsetail (the above ground parts) are commonly used in herbal supplements.
